Are you ready to plan your Future? Here at GXO, we are currently recruiting for a MI Planning Manager to join our team in Avonmouth, joining one of our new business wins! As a MI Planning Manager, you will focus on the efficient short and long term planning of core staffing and temporary agency volumes while developing and maintaining...
